Career path
| Career Role | Description |
|---|---|
| Disaster Finance Analyst (UK) | Analyze financial risks and develop mitigation strategies for disaster events. Expertise in insurance, risk assessment, and financial modeling is crucial for this high-demand role. |
| Catastrophe Risk Modeler (UK) | Develop and implement sophisticated models to assess and quantify catastrophe risks, providing vital insights for disaster finance professionals. Strong programming and statistical skills are essential. |
| Disaster Recovery Finance Manager (UK) | Oversee the financial aspects of disaster recovery, including funding allocation, insurance claims, and financial reporting. Requires excellent leadership and financial management skills. |
| Insurance Underwriter (Catastrophe) (UK) | Assess and underwrite insurance policies related to catastrophic events. Requires deep understanding of risk assessment, actuarial science and disaster finance principles. |
| Financial Resilience Consultant (Disaster Risk) (UK) | Advise organizations on building financial resilience against disasters. This impactful role combines financial expertise with knowledge of disaster risk management. |
